Transaction c76c270f725a947bc8a0542d299763e9075cfbd6eb35158a6a9a1e3a2cc79560
1 Input
1 Output
-
c76c270f725a947bc8a0542d299763e9075cfbd6eb35158a6a9a1e3a2cc79560:0
- value
- 60636
- script pubkey
- OP_0 OP_PUSHBYTES_20 c86f052ba7535b89489d841d00383da8145aaaea
- address
- bc1qephs22a82ddcjjyasswsqwpa4q2942h2649zt9